Subject: Retirement of the Merrow Line

Team,

We will retire the Merrow product line at fiscal year-end. Support continues for existing units through the sunset period; no new orders after next month. Inventory will be cleared via the Fenwick channel. Staffing reallocations go to Operations. Department heads should brief their teams. Background on this decision appears below.

confidential, kagup-bafog: Fraaxax Group is in early talks to buy Soroxox Group for about $343.8 million. The Olidor launch date is June 14, and nothing goes to the press before then. Legal wants the Aldmirek Logistics term sheet signed before July 23.

Subject: Handover — TilePull prefetcher

Taking over TilePull releases as of Monday. Prefetcher v2.4 is staged; it now batches map-tile requests per zoom level and respects the Quorvane CDN rate caps. Review the diff in the fetch scheduler before cutting the tag. Pipeline is green. Everything ships from the release branch, signed with the key that follows.

release key, fajof-fawef: bky19_jNcDy5ia68rvEn25WjQ

MEMO — Kettling Depot Receiving

Uniform sets for the new Kettling depot arrive Wednesday via Ashgrove courier: 40 boxes, sorted by size, manifest attached to box one. Check the count at the dock before signing; shortages go straight to stores, not the courier. The hand-over instruction the courier will follow is set out below.

drop instructions, tafof-baguf: the holmir gilox courier leaves the sormir ulaok holdor ledger at gate 5596 under passcode 257343

When reviewing changes to the Fernhold greenhouse controller, pay close attention to the sensor drift compensation module. Humidity probes in zone arrays drift upward roughly 0.3% per week, and the controller recalibrates nightly against the reference probe. Any change to the recalibration window must preserve that cadence. The drift model's derivation and tuning notes are documented on the internal page here.

dashboard of kawig-yagug = https://confluence.tolvaqsys.internal/browse/pages/pages/pages/c3ab